MIAMI – The 2018 FIU Football Spring Game will take place on Friday, April 6, under the lights at Riccardo Silva Stadium. Kickoff is set for 7 p.m., and admission is FREE to the public.
Gates open at 6 p.m. with all fans attending the Spring Game receiving a FREE football mini-poster. All alumni and fans are encouraged to enter through Gate 9 (north side of the stadium). FIU students are encouraged to enter through Gate 7 (northeast side of the stadium). The first 150 FIU students attending the game will receive a camo FIU hat. Concession stands will be open during the game.
There will be a VIP experience for fans purchasing or renewing season tickets.
Following the game, fans will have the opportunity to take part in an on-field meet and greet and a chance to collect autographs with this year's Panthers squad, scheduled to begin at 8:30 p.m.
PARKING
With the Youth Fair underway, increased traffic is expected. All fans are encouraged to enter campus through the 112th Avenue & 8th Street entrance. Once on campus, fans are encouraged to park in Panther Garage or Lot 10 (located behind the arena). Additional limited parking may be found at FIU Soccer Stadium, CSC (located west of the baseball stadium), Lot 7 & Lot 8.
UP NEXT
The 2018 FIU football season will feature five bowl teams from the 2017 season, a home opener against Big Ten member Indiana and the renewal of the series with Miami (Fla.) – the defending Atlantic Coast Conference Coastal Division winner. FIU opens the season with Indiana on Sept. 1.
FIU faces 2017 bowl teams in Boca Raton Bowl and 2017 C-USA champion Florida Atlantic, Gildan New Mexico Bowl champion Marshall, Raycom Camellia Bowl champion Middle Tennessee, AutoNation Cure Bowl participant WKU and Orange Bowl participant Miami.
